Mayor says devolution over housing development grant funding is “coming through” its negotiations with Whitehall
Andy Burnham has said ongoing talks with Whitehall about the devolution of ‘London-style’ powers over housing development grant to Greater Manchester have been positive.
Burnham, in an exclusive interview with Housing Today’s sister publication Building last week, said that negotiations with central government have progressed over the past few weeks despite this summer’s political turmoil.
Greater Manchester Combined Authority (GMCA and West Midlands Combined Authority) were named last year as ‘trailblazers’, becoming the first two authorities to discuss devolution deals under the government’s levelling up agenda.
